Merging Documents

With the Combine tool, you can combine open documents into a multi-page document and optionally apply variable data. The resulting file is automatically nested for minimum media usage applying an outline-based positioning.

How to merge documents
    1. Choose File > Combine. The Combine dialog is displayed.
    2. Activate the option Combine Opened Files into Multipage Document.
    3. Enter a name for the resulting document.
    4. Click OK.
All opened files are merged into a new multi-page document.
